BRENTHONNE

Département : Haute-Savoie

Blason de Brenthonne/Arms (crest) of Brenthonne
Official blazon
French

Écartelé : aux 1er et 4e d'or à l'arbre de sinople, au 2e d'azur au soleil d'or, au 3e d'azur à deux demi-vols affrontés d'argent ; le tout sommé d'un chef de gueules à la croix d'argent.

English blazon wanted

Origin/meaning

The first and fourth quarter show a tree, a symbol for the cultivation of fruit trees in the area. The other two quarters show the arms of two families that ruled the village; the sun from the Bellamy and the wings from the De Saint Michel family.

The chief shows the cross of Savoy.
